How to preserve the motor!?

hey pplz,
im a noobie to this site and to rotary's all together and i was wondering what i should know about keeping my motor from blowing up. Its been freshly imported for Japan and is a rx7 series 5 savvana turbo. its has the 13b-t. im running an aftermarket zorst, ecu, external wastegate, aftermarket radiator (nice and thick alluminium) and more that i probably cant tell from the outside. im gona have it tuned to aussie petrol cause we have **** octane.

You guys know what i can do to keep it from blowing up? or which petrol is best to use? any reponse appreciated.

A major factor to the motor blowing is heat. I'd recomed getting an intercooler either a front mount or v-mount and then keeping your boost low at around 12 psi. That should keep ur motor running for awhile. The lower your boost the longer your motor will last. Hope that helps a little
